Output 7d32b30b5836454df88444ca9ac4ba9cddc2f6d27e80596a7e22f2ee8f7582dd:0

value
23978684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c108f970594a52a24147b2cf77f433657aae984d OP_EQUAL
address
3KHh67kbCZG4Xqnc4PdviefKbpGDnTp54q
transaction
7d32b30b5836454df88444ca9ac4ba9cddc2f6d27e80596a7e22f2ee8f7582dd
spent
true